02 Description
CNA: mitrelibnfs through 6.0.2 before 935b8db has an xid integer underflow in READ_IOVEC in rpc_read_from_socket in lib/socket.c during a connection to a crafted NFS server, when the expected pdu size exceeds
03 Exploitation and scoring
SRC: CISA, FIRST, NVD, RED HAT- Exploitation
- Assessed, none found. CISA's assessment recorded neither public exploit code nor evidence of exploitation when it was made.
- SSVC decision
- ExploitationnoneCISA recorded no public exploit code and no evidence of exploitation.
- AutomatablenoAt least one step from reconnaissance to exploitation cannot be reliably automated.
- Technical ImpacttotalSuccessful exploitation gives total control of the vulnerable component.
CISA publishes the decision points, not a final SSVC decision. The decision also depends on mission and well-being impact, which is a property of your deployment rather than of the vulnerability.- EPSS probability
- 0.19% probability of exploitation activity in the next 30 days.
